God's Battalions: The Case for the Crusades by Rodney Stark

Go to review page

4.0

Stark presents a vastly different view compared to the common narrative of the Crusades. I would recommend that any person read this: Christian, Muslim, or one just interested in history. The main thesis is that the Crusades were not unprovoked, and that the common suggested motives for the crusaders (wealth, hatred, etc.) are not historical or sensical.
